Mediation cost in Albuquerque, NM
A typical Mediation figure in Albuquerque is about $270 per hour, about 10% below the national figure of $300.
Typical cost
Typical in Albuquerque
$270
per hour
- On the low end
- $135
- On the high end
- $450
Estimated from national price data, adjusted for the cost of living in Albuquerque. Insurance, coverage, and the details of your situation can change the real number a lot. Not a quote.
